请问网络服务器怎么设置,网络服务器配置指南,从入门到精通
- 综合资讯
- 2024-11-13 10:48:24
- 2

网络服务器配置指南,从入门到精通,涵盖设置网络服务器的详细步骤,包括基础知识、配置文件编辑、安全设置、性能优化等,助您逐步掌握网络服务器配置的全面知识。...
网络服务器配置指南,从入门到精通,涵盖设置网络服务器的详细步骤,包括基础知识、配置文件编辑、安全设置、性能优化等,助您逐步掌握网络服务器配置的全面知识。
随着互联网技术的不断发展,网络服务器已成为现代企业、机构和个人不可或缺的组成部分,如何设置网络服务器,使其稳定、高效地运行,成为许多人关心的问题,本文将为您详细介绍网络服务器的设置方法,从入门到精通,助您轻松应对各类网络服务器配置难题。
网络服务器概述
网络服务器是一种提供网络服务的计算机系统,其主要功能是为客户端提供数据传输、数据处理、存储等服务,常见的网络服务器有Web服务器、邮件服务器、数据库服务器等,以下将以Web服务器为例,介绍网络服务器的设置方法。
Web服务器设置
1、选择Web服务器软件
目前市面上主流的Web服务器软件有Apache、Nginx、IIS等,以下将分别介绍这三种软件的配置方法。
(1)Apache
Apache是一款开源的Web服务器软件,广泛应用于各类服务器,以下是Apache的配置步骤:
① 安装Apache:在Linux系统中,可以使用以下命令安装Apache:
sudo apt-get install apache2
在Windows系统中,可以从Apache官网下载安装包进行安装。
② 配置Apache:在Linux系统中,Apache的配置文件位于/etc/apache2/
目录下,打开apache2.conf
文件,根据需要修改以下参数:
ServerName
:设置服务器域名。
DocumentRoot
:设置网站根目录。
ErrorLog
:设置错误日志文件路径。
CustomLog
:设置访问日志文件路径。
在Windows系统中,Apache的配置文件位于安装目录下的conf文件夹中,打开httpd.conf文件,根据需要修改以下参数:
ServerName
:设置服务器域名。
DocumentRoot
:设置网站根目录。
ErrorLog
:设置错误日志文件路径。
CustomLog
:设置访问日志文件路径。
③ 启动Apache:在Linux系统中,可以使用以下命令启动Apache:
sudo systemctl start apache2
在Windows系统中,可以通过Apache安装程序启动Apache。
(2)Nginx
Nginx是一款高性能的Web服务器软件,适用于高并发场景,以下是Nginx的配置步骤:
① 安装Nginx:在Linux系统中,可以使用以下命令安装Nginx:
sudo apt-get install nginx
在Windows系统中,可以从Nginx官网下载安装包进行安装。
② 配置Nginx:Nginx的配置文件位于安装目录下的conf文件夹中,打开nginx.conf文件,根据需要修改以下参数:
server
:设置服务器监听地址、端口、网站根目录、错误日志文件路径等。
③ 启动Nginx:在Linux系统中,可以使用以下命令启动Nginx:
sudo systemctl start nginx
在Windows系统中,可以通过Nginx安装程序启动Nginx。
(3)IIS
IIS是微软公司开发的一款Web服务器软件,适用于Windows系统,以下是IIS的配置步骤:
① 安装IIS:在Windows系统中,可以通过控制面板中的“程序和功能”选项,选择“添加功能”来安装IIS。
② 配置IIS:在IIS管理器中,创建网站,设置网站名称、网站域名、网站根目录、IP地址和端口等。
2、部署网站
将网站文件上传到服务器上的网站根目录,即可通过浏览器访问网站。
邮件服务器设置
1、选择邮件服务器软件
常见的邮件服务器软件有Postfix、Sendmail、Exchange等,以下将以Postfix为例,介绍邮件服务器的配置方法。
2、配置Postfix
① 安装Postfix:在Linux系统中,可以使用以下命令安装Postfix:
sudo apt-get install postfix
② 配置Postfix:在Linux系统中,Postfix的配置文件位于/etc/postfix/
目录下,打开main.cf
文件,根据需要修改以下参数:
myhostname
:设置邮件服务器域名。
mydomain
:设置邮件服务器域名。
myorigin
:设置发件人域名。
mynetworks
:设置允许发送邮件的网络。
relayhost
:设置邮件转发服务器。
③ 重启Postfix:在Linux系统中,可以使用以下命令重启Postfix:
sudo systemctl restart postfix
数据库服务器设置
1、选择数据库服务器软件
常见的数据库服务器软件有MySQL、Oracle、SQL Server等,以下将以MySQL为例,介绍数据库服务器的配置方法。
2、配置MySQL
① 安装MySQL:在Linux系统中,可以使用以下命令安装MySQL:
sudo apt-get install mysql-server
在Windows系统中,可以从MySQL官网下载安装包进行安装。
② 配置MySQL:在Linux系统中,MySQL的配置文件位于/etc/mysql/
目录下,打开my.cnf
文件,根据需要修改以下参数:
bind-address
:设置MySQL服务器监听的IP地址。
port
:设置MySQL服务器监听的端口号。
max_connections
:设置MySQL服务器最大连接数。
③ 重启MySQL:在Linux系统中,可以使用以下命令重启MySQL:
sudo systemctl restart mysql
本文从Web服务器、邮件服务器、数据库服务器三个方面,详细介绍了网络服务器的设置方法,通过学习本文,您应该能够轻松应对各类网络服务器配置难题,在实际操作过程中,请根据实际情况进行调整,以确保网络服务器稳定、高效地运行。
本文链接:https://zhitaoyun.cn/798192.html
发表评论